Kano Pillars’ defeat in the ‘Old Kano’ Derby with Jigawa Golden Stars has caused theSai Masu Gidato drop a step further to No 3 on the Nigerian Professional Football League (NPFL) standing.
Nasarawa United who drew goalless with Enyimba in Aba have stepped up to the second spot while Rivers United maintain their fourth place.
Both Kwara United and Enyimba have their positions unchanged – fifth and sixth respectively.
At the danger zone, FC IfeanyiUbah climbed to the top of the bottom four, just as Sunshine Stars swap their 19th spot with Warri Wolves, formerly at No.18.
There were no away wins at the weekend.
